Shiba Inu (SHIB) has regained momentum, reaching a two-month high and surpassing Litecoin (LTC) in the global crypto ranking.
Shiba Inu has continued its rally, which began two weeks ago. The renewed rally pushed its price to a two-month high of $0.00001587 in the early hours of today.
At the moment, Shiba Inu is up 5.43% over the past 24 hours, 15.36% in the past week, and 39.47% over the past 30 days. Currently priced at $0.00001586, Shiba Inu boasts a valuation of $9.34 billion.
However, the milestone was short-lived as Litecoin pushed Shiba Inu down to the 19th position over the weekend. Notably, Shiba Inu has reclaimed the 18th place in the ranking, having rallied 5.43% over the past 24 hours.
In the meantime, the difference between the market caps of Shiba Inu and Litecoin is less than $200 million. While SHIB is valued at $9.34 billion, Litecoin’s market cap stands at approximately $9.15 billion.
Shiba Inu Burn Rate Spikes 2,815% in 24 Hours
Notably, the development follows a significant spike in Shiba Inu’s burn rate. New data from Shibburn indicates that the burn rate has increased by 2,866% over the past 24 hours. This resulted in the incineration of 2,196,079 (2.19 million) SHIB tokens over the past day, across 14 transactions.
The highest daily burn occurred yesterday at 11:29 a.m. (UTC), which saw an unknown address, 0x188…c3cdd, send 1 million SHIB to the official burn wallet.
Besides the 1 million SHIB burn, the sender was responsible for seven other burn-related transactions over the past day. Of the 2.19 million Shiba Inu tokens burned over the past day, this address incinerated 1,343,285 (1.34 million) SHIB.
Although Shiba Inu’s daily burn rate has soared 2,815%, the metric still represents a 89.53% low compared to the past week.
